Article: Former Malaysian PM says 'whip-for-drinking-beer' model's sentence 'too harsh'.

Byline: ANI

Petaling Jaya (Malaysia), Aug. 26 (ANI): Former Malaysian Prime Minister Dr Mahathir Mohammad has expressed concern over the whipping sentence given to part-time model Kartika Sari Dewi Shukarno for drinking beer, saying the punishment is "too harsh."

Dr. Mohammad questioned the fairness of the harsh decision in his blog post, asking if Islam didn't allow mercy for first time offenders, The Star reports.
